Pro tip: Watch out for signings at big cons getting way too crowded

I went to Fan Expo Chicago last weekend and man, the line for Jim Lee's booth was insane. I got there at 8am thinking I'd be early and there were already like 200 people camped out. Security kept saying they'd cap it at 250 but nobody listened. I saw a guy near me get his hardcover bent because someone pushed into him when the crowd surged. The organizers had one tiny rope barrier for a guy who draws for DC and Marvel, you'd think they'd prepare better. By noon they just closed the line and told everyone else to go home. Has anyone else dealt with getting stuck in those crazy artist alley mobs?
